Hiking around Kleblach-Lind offers a diverse landscape at the foot of the Gailtal Alps, extending along the Drau River. The region features a mix of gentle hills and prominent mountain peaks, providing varied terrain for outdoor activities. The Drau Valley forms a significant natural feature, with the Kreuzeck Group and Goldeck Mountain offering higher elevation routes. This area is characterized by its river valleys, alpine foothills, and forested slopes.

Best hiking trails around Kleblach-Lind

  • The most popular hiking route is Goldeck Summit Cross – Ridge Trail Between Goldeck and Martenock loop from Goldeck, a 5.2 miles (8.3 km) difficult trail that takes 3 hours 6 minutes to complete. This route features a ridge trail and leads to the Goldeck Summit Cross.
  • Another top favourite among local hikers is Goldeck Alm – Goldeck Summit Cross loop from Goldeck, a difficult 4.9 miles (7.9 km) path. This trail ascends past Goldeck Alm towards the summit cross, offering views of the surrounding mountains.
  • Local hikers also love the Seehütte – Goldeck cable car mountain station loop from Goldeck, a 1.9 miles (3.0 km) trail leading through the Goldeck area, often completed in about 58 minutes. This easy route connects the Seehütte with the cable car mountain station.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many hiking trails are available around Kleblach-Lind?

Kleblach-Lind offers a comprehensive network of over 10 hiking trails. These routes cater to various skill levels, including easy walks, moderate excursions, and challenging mountain ascents, ensuring there's something for every hiker.

Are there any easy hiking trails suitable for beginners or families?

Yes, Kleblach-Lind has several easy trails. For instance, the Seehütte – Goldeck cable car mountain station loop from Goldeck is an easy 3.0 km route that takes about an hour to complete. Another accessible option is the Goldeck cable car mountain station – Seehütte loop from Goldeck, a 4.2 km path that also offers a gentle experience.

What kind of terrain can I expect on hikes in Kleblach-Lind?

The terrain around Kleblach-Lind is highly varied. You'll find gentle paths along the Drau River in the valley, rolling hills, and more rugged, steep ascents in the Gailtal Alps and Kreuzeck Group. Many routes traverse dense forests, open meadows, and offer panoramic views from mountain peaks like Goldeck, Latschur, and Stagor.

Are there any circular hiking routes in the area?

Yes, many trails around Kleblach-Lind are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end at the same point. Examples include the challenging Goldeck Summit Cross – Ridge Trail Between Goldeck and Martenock loop from Goldeck and the moderate Radlberger Alm – Stagor Summit 360° View loop from Radlberger Alm.

What are some notable natural features or landmarks to see while hiking?

The region is rich in natural beauty. You can explore the scenic Drau Valley, witness the dramatic backdrop of the Gailtal Alps, or ascend to peaks in the Kreuzeck Group. Nearby, you can visit the Barbarossa Gorge Waterfall or the impressive Weißenbach Gorge. The area also features beautiful lakes like Lake Millstatt, offering refreshing views and opportunities for a dip.

Are there any hikes with particularly good viewpoints?

Absolutely. Hikes to summits like Latschur, Stagor, and the Goldeck Summit Cross are renowned for their overwhelming panoramas. The Goldeck Alm – Goldeck Summit Cross loop from Goldeck, for instance, offers extensive views of the surrounding mountains as you ascend towards the summit cross. You can also find specific viewpoints like View of Seeboden and Lake Millstatt.

What do other hikers say about the trails in Kleblach-Lind?

The hiking trails in Kleblach-Lind are highly regarded by the komoot community, holding an average rating of 4.6 stars from over 8,500 reviews. Hikers frequently praise the diverse landscapes, from river valleys to mountain peaks, and the well-maintained paths that cater to all experience levels.

Is Kleblach-Lind a good destination for challenging mountain hikes?

Yes, for experienced hikers seeking a challenge, Kleblach-Lind provides access to demanding mountain routes. The Kreuzeck Group, for example, offers trails to peaks like Latschur and Stagor, which require good fitness, sure-footedness, sturdy shoes, and alpine experience. A multi-day crossing of the Kreuzeck group is also a recommended mountain experience for those looking for an extended adventure.

Can I find places to eat or stay along the hiking routes?

While specific cafes or pubs directly on every trail are not guaranteed, some mountain areas, like Goldeck, feature huts such as the Goldeckhütte. These huts often provide food and drinks, along with great views. The region also has lakeside inns, particularly around areas like Millstätter See, where you can find refreshment after your hike.

What is the best time of year to go hiking in Kleblach-Lind?

Kleblach-Lind is a wonderful hiking area in every season. Spring and autumn offer pleasant temperatures and vibrant natural colors, while summer is ideal for higher alpine routes and enjoying refreshing dips in nearby lakes. Even winter provides opportunities for scenic hikes, especially in areas like Goldeck, which is described as a great hiking area year-round.

Are there any trails that feature waterfalls or gorges?

Yes, the region around Kleblach-Lind includes several impressive natural water features. You can explore the Barbarossa Gorge Waterfall or venture into the Water Adventure Trail in the Gnoppnitz Gorge for a unique experience.

Are there any long-distance hiking trails accessible from Kleblach-Lind?

Yes, the area is part of longer trail networks. The "Drauradweg" is a well-developed cycling and hiking trail that allows you to explore the Drau Valley. Additionally, the "Goldeck – Weissensee – Ruperti" long-distance hiking trail passes through the region, offering extended trekking opportunities.
